Charting a Course



Our Core Doctrine:

The Scripture is complete, sufficient, and finished; therefore, it is fixed for all time.

Our Core Values:

The Scripture determines what we value as authentic disciples of Christ. It proclaims the driving force behind all that we do as a family.

Integrity is a discipline of life presented in the Scriptures, modeled by Christ, and empowered by the Holy Spirit, in order that we become blameless in all things.

Servanthood desires to meet the legitimate spiritual, emotional, and physical needs of others as presented in the Scriptures, modeled by Christ, and empowered by the Holy Spirit.

Scripture is God's specific revelation of truth to mankind; authored by Himself, recorded by men as they were moved by the Holy Spirit, so that it was complete and without error in the original writings. It has been preserved through the ages so it is mankind's final authority for all faith and practice.

Discipleship is the cyclical process by which authentic disciples reproduce themselves in a third spiritual generation by co-laboring with God in His work of drawing, converting, and training of His chosen ones as they are being conformed to Christ.

Relevancy is the lifestyle of an authentic disciple who lives and communicates truth in an understandable manner which neither distracts from nor compromises the truth as presented in the Scripture.

Worship is the act by which authentic disciples gladly reflect back God's worth as presented in the Scripture for His pleasure and their greatest delight (in other words, worship is why we were created to begin with).

Core Purpose Statement as a family:

We exist to bring God pleasure by stating His worth, by living out His supremacy in our lives, and by making authentic disciples of Christ through evangelizing the lost, nurturing and edifying the chosen wherever the Holy Spirit directs; so they can find their greatest satisfaction in Him (Of course we have three built in disciples to teach).

Proverbs 16:3

Commit your works to the Lord

And your plans will be established.
